Welcome to The Great Smoky Mountains. This map is based on a fictional location representing the southern part of the Great Smoky Mountains. Here, you'll find a variety of terrains ranging from relatively flat land to very steep hills. You start with a large cotton farm equipped with all necessary tools. You'll also begin with sheep, goats, chickens, and horses that you'll need to care for. Aside from the starter farm, there are 7 farms available for purchase, 47 fields, and 120 farmlands. If you prefer not to do much farming, plenty of trees are available for mountain forestry. The map features multiple production points and selling stations, including bakeries, carpentry, dairy, farmers market, grain mill, oil mill, piano manufacturing, supermarket, sawmill, spinnery, and tailor shop. Buy points include animal trader, gas station, warehouse, and vehicle dealer. New and updated features include new crops such as alfalfa, clover, flowering catchcrop, green rye, rye, spelt, silage maize, triticale, vetched rye, winter wheat, and winter barley. The map introduces a row crop system, additional ground angles, stubble destruction, updated textures, a custom planting and harvest calendar, more paintable textures, new crops for animal feed, and updated silos and bunkers. Weather patterns now match the location with custom sunrises, sunsets, very dark nights, and custom lighting and tornados. Production capacities and outputs have been increased, and silos at farms support multiple fruits. If you have the Highlands pack, you'll have access to a boat, which cannot be sold and won't return to its start point if reset. In multiplayer, only the host can access the boat; other players will see it under the map. Enjoy the map! Special thanks to IKAS FanModding for the buildings and InsaneSimGuy for the silo.
